Heat Conductivity and Durability: Aluminum vs Stainless Steel

When selecting materials for applications demanding both efficient heat transfer and robust durability, aluminum and stainless steel frequently emerge as top contenders. Aluminum boasts remarkable thermal conductivity, rapidly transferring heat to dissipate it effectively. This characteristic makes it a popular choice for applications like heat sinks, cookware, and radiators. Conversely, stainless steel, with its inherent strength and corrosion resistance, offers exceptional durability against wear, tear, and environmental factors. Consequently both materials exhibit distinct advantages that cater to specific needs. Aluminum's lightweight nature and superior heat transfer properties make it ideal for applications where rapid cooling is paramount, while stainless steel's toughness and resistance to corrosion suit demanding environments requiring long-lasting performance.

Aluminum and Stainless Steel Pots and Pans: Pros and Cons

When it comes to choosing the right cookware for your kitchen, aluminuim and stainless steel are two of the most popular options. Both materials offer distinct advantages and disadvantages, so diligently considering your needs is crucial before making a decision.

Aluminum, known for its excellent heat conductivity, heats up quickly and evenly, making it ideal for tasks like sauteing and boiling. It's also lightweight and affordable. However, aluminum can react with acidic foods, maybe altering their taste and leaching into your meals.

Stainless steel, on the other hand, is durable, rust-resistant, and doesn't react with food. It's a good choice for a wide range of cooking methods, including simmering, searing, and baking. However, stainless steel can frequently be slower to heat up than aluminum and may require more attention to prevent sticking.

Ultimately, the best choice for you depends on your individual preferences and cooking style.
